About the Holiday Inn Express & Suites Pasadena - Los Angeles, an IHG Hotel
Holiday Inn Express & Suites Pasadena - Los Angeles, an IHG Hotel, is a modern and stylish lodging option located in the heart of Pasadena, California. Situated at 3500 East Colorado Boulevard, this hotel offers convenient access to popular attractions such as the Rose Bowl Stadium, Old Town Pasadena, and the Huntington Library.
Guests can enjoy comfortable and well-appointed rooms and suites, each equipped with amenities such as flat-screen TVs, free Wi-Fi, and plush bedding. The hotel also offers a complimentary hot breakfast buffet, a fitness center, and an outdoor pool for guests to relax and unwind.
Whether traveling for business or leisure, Holiday Inn Express & Suites Pasadena - Los Angeles provides a welcoming and convenient stay for all guests visiting the beautiful city of Pasadena.
